The first three parts of New York"s monumental vegetable survey, richly illustrated with colour studies of historic pea, bean and sweet corn varieties. In the publisher's original paper wraps. First editions of the first three separately issued parts of Volume I, published as reports of the New York State Agricultural Experiment Station. Three parts of four, lacking the fourth part,The Cucurbits, published in 1937. Illustrated with twenty-four full-page colour illustrations to Part I, thirty-nine to Part II, and twenty-four to Part III. Collated, complete. A detailed scientific and horticultural survey of cultivated peas, beans and sweet corn, tracing their histories and classification while documenting the numerous varieties grown or trialled in New York. The individual varieties are described in detail, including their origins, maturity, yield, formation, seed characteristics, culinary quality and suitability for market-garden or canning cultivation. Compromising: 1928 Volume I, Part I: Peas of New York by U. P. Hedrick, assisted by F. H. Hall, L. R. Hawthorn and Alwin Berger. Issued as the Station"s report for the year ending 30 June 1928. 1931 Volume I, Part II: Beans of New York by U. P. Hedrick, assisted by W. T. Tapley, G. P. Van Eseltine and W. D. Enzie. Issued as the Station"s report for the year ending 30 June 1931. 1934 Volume I, Part III: Sweet Corn by William T. Tapley, Walter D. Enzie and Glen P. Van Eseltine. Issued as the Station"s report for the year ending 30 June 1934. An appealing and unusually detailed record of historic American vegetable varieties. In the publisher"s original paper wraps.
